QAPI Committee Missing Required Members
Summary
The facility failed to ensure its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ement (QAPI) committee consisted of the required members. A review of the undated document titled "Euclid Beach QAPI Members" showed the committee was intended to include the Committee Chairperson, Administrator, DON, Medical Director, Dietary Representative, Pharmacy Representative, Social Service Representative, Activities Representative, Environmental Service Representative, Infection Control Representative, Rehabilitative/Restorative Services Representative, Staff Development Representative, Safety Representative, and Medical Records Representative. Review of the QAPI meeting records showed the required members were not consistently present. The QAPI Plan dated 01/30/25 showed the meeting was attended by LNHA #629 and DON #623, with no indication or sign-in sheet verifying attendance by the Medical Director or Infection Control Representative. The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ement Meeting dated 03/25/25 had no representative for infection control, the sign-in sheet was void of an infection control signature, and the infection control portion of the document was blank. The Ad-Hoc QAPI Committee Meeting dated 05/29/25 had no signature for the Medical Director and no representative for infection control noted on the sign-in sheet. On 09/02/25 at 12:29 P.M., the RDO #599 verified the lack of an Infection Control Preventionist at the QAPI meetings dated 01/30/25, 03/25/25, and 05/29/25, and verified the absence of the Medical Director at the QAPI meetings dated 01/30/25 and 05/29/25.
